Tofu is a popular food that has been consumed for centuries, especially in East Asian cuisine. It is made from soybeans and has a unique texture and taste. If you’re new to tofu, you may have some questions about it. Here are answers to 10 of the most commonly asked questions about tofu:

  1. WHAT IS TOFU?

Tofu is a plant-based food made from soybeans. The soybeans are ground into a paste, which is then mixed with water, heated, and curdled with a coagulant. The resulting curds are then pressed into blocks, which can be used in a variety of dishes.

  1. WHAT ARE THE BENEFITS OF EATING TOFU?

Tofu is a good source of protein and contains all nine essential amino acids. It is also low in calories and fat and contains no cholesterol. Additionally, tofu contains iron, calcium, and other essential minerals.

  1. WHAT DOES TOFU TASTE LIKE?

Tofu has a mild, slightly nutty taste. It is often described as having a “neutral” flavor, which makes it a versatile ingredient that can be used in both sweet and savory dishes.

  1. WHAT TEXTURES OF TOFU ARE AVAILABLE?

Tofu is available in a range of textures, from soft and silky to firm and chewy. Soft tofu is often used in soups and smoothies, while firmer tofu is better for grilling, frying, and stir-frying.

  1. HOW DO I COOK WITH TOFU?

Tofu can be cooked in a variety of ways, including grilling, frying, baking, and stir-frying. It can be used in both sweet and savory dishes and is often used as a meat substitute in vegetarian and vegan dishes.

  1. HOW LONG DOES TOFU LAST?

Tofu can be stored in the refrigerator for up to one week. Once opened, it should be kept in water and refrigerated, with the water changed every day or two.

  1. CAN I FREEZE TOFU?

Yes, tofu can be frozen. However, freezing can change the texture of the tofu, so it may not be as firm or chewy once thawed. Frozen tofu is best used in dishes where the texture is less important, such as soups and smoothies.

  1. IS TOFU SUITABLE FOR PEOPLE WITH FOOD ALLERGIES?

Tofu is made from soybeans, which can cause allergies in some people. If you have a soy allergy, you should avoid eating tofu.

  1. HOW MUCH TOFU SHOULD I EAT?

The recommended serving size for tofu is about 100 grams, or 3.5 ounces. This provides about 10 grams of protein and is a good source of essential nutrients.

10 Lesser Known Facts About Tofu

  1. TOFU ORIGINATED IN CHINA Tofu is believed to have originated in China over 2,000 years ago. It was then introduced to Japan, where it became a popular food staple.
  2. IT WAS ORIGINALLY MADE BY ACCIDENT Legend has it that tofu was first made by a Chinese chef who accidentally curdled soy milk while making another dish.
  3. TOFU IS KNOWN BY MANY NAMES Tofu is also known as bean curd, soybean curd, and doufu in different parts of the world.
  4. THERE ARE MANY DIFFERENT TYPES OF TOFU Tofu comes in a variety of textures, including soft, firm, and extra-firm. It can also be flavored or smoked.
  5. IT’S A VERSATILE INGREDIENT Tofu is a versatile ingredient that can be used in a variety of dishes, including soups, stir-fries, salads, and desserts.
  6. IT’S A GOOD SOURCE OF PROTEIN Tofu is a great source of plant-based protein and contains all nine essential amino acids.
  7. TOFU CAN BE USED AS AN EGG REPLACEMENT Tofu can be used as an egg replacement in many dishes, such as quiches, omelets, and scrambles.
  8. TOFU IS A GOOD SOURCE OF IRON Tofu is also a good source of iron, which is important for maintaining healthy blood.
  9. IT CAN BE FROZEN Tofu can be frozen, which can change its texture. Frozen tofu is best used in soups and smoothies.
  10. TOFU CAN BE USED TO MAKE CHEESE Tofu can be used as a base for making plant-based cheese, such as tofu ricotta or tofu cream cheese.
